Old Boots left this review about The Daisy

Large pub which goes back further than you’d think, inside is more multi room than expected with two small front rooms, one with seating, one with a pool table. Further back is the main bar with the counter to the left, roughly divided into two areas , the rear part being down a step. There’s lots of comfortable seating, mostly banquettes at wooden topped cast iron tables. One T-Bar and a range of solos serve what appears to be every macro lager available plus a couple of ciders and smooths plus of course Guinness. Decorated with multiple screens and machines, the place is a veritable shrine to Leeds United with a huge mural on an outside wall, badges, photos and even part of the paint job is yellow and blue.

Alan Winfield left this review about The Daisy

The Daisy is a looks like a well kept stone built pub.
Once inside the pub has three separate rooms,there is a small snug to the front left and a pool room to the front right,the main room is to the rear,this is larger and oblong shaped,the seating is comfy bench type and small stools,there was a TV on showing horse racing.
There was one real ale on the bar which was John Smiths Cask,this was a decent drink.
Decent background music was playing.
I quite liked this pub.
